Indanapur

Indanapur is a village located in Gangapur tehsil of Ganjam district in Odisha, India. It is situated 28km away from sub-district headquarter Gangapur (tehsildar office) and 82km away from district headquarter Chatrapur. As per 2009 stats, Khairaputi is the gram panchayat of Indanapur village.

About Indanap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Indanapur is 410728. The village spans a total geographical area of 143 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 761123. Bhanjanagar is nearest town to Indanap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 21km away.

Population of Indanapur

According to the 2011 Census, Indanapur has a total population of about 1,248, with approximately 631 males and 617 females. The sex ratio is around 977 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 135 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 69 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population includes 1 person. The overall literacy rate is approximately 71.63%, with male literacy at about 82.88% and female literacy near 60.13%. There are around 254 households in the village. Connectivity of Indanap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Indanapur. As per the 2011 stats, Indanap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
